Using a washing machine involves a few clear steps: first, sort clothes by color and fabric type to prevent damage or color bleeding; next, load the clothes evenly into the drum without overfilling; add the correct amount of detergent (and fabric softener if needed) into the designated compartments; select the appropriate wash cycle based on fabric type and dirt level; set water temperature if required; then start the machine; once the cycle finishes, remove clothes promptly to avoid wrinkles or odor and proceed to drying. Proper use ensures effective cleaning, longer fabric life, and efficient machine performance.

What You Need to Start a Cleaning Business

Starting a cleaning business requires a combination of planning, legal setup, and operational readiness. You need to choose a specific service type such as residential, commercial, or specialized cleaning, and register your business legally based on your country’s requirements. Basic equipment like cleaning supplies, tools, and transportation is essential, along with insurance to protect against liability risks. Creating a pricing structure, marketing strategy, and customer acquisition plan helps establish credibility and attract clients. Maintaining consistent service quality and building trust are critical for long-term growth and repeat business.


Best Methods for Cleaning Windows Without Streaks

Achieving streak-free windows depends on using the right tools, solution, and technique. A simple mixture of water and vinegar or a mild detergent effectively removes dirt and grease without leaving residue, while microfiber cloths or squeegees help prevent streaks by evenly distributing and removing moisture. Cleaning windows on a cloudy day avoids rapid drying that causes streak marks, and working from top to bottom ensures consistent results. Regular maintenance and proper drying methods are essential for maintaining clear, spotless glass surfaces over time.


Effective Ways to Prevent Infection in Everyday Life

The most effective way to prevent infection is to combine proper hygiene practices with preventive healthcare measures. Regular handwashing with soap and clean water significantly reduces the spread of pathogens, while maintaining personal and environmental cleanliness lowers exposure risks. Vaccination strengthens the immune system against specific diseases, and avoiding close contact with infected individuals helps limit transmission. Additionally, safe food handling, clean drinking water, and responsible use of medical treatments such as antibiotics contribute to reducing infection rates and protecting overall health.


How to Remove Coffee Stains from Carpet Effectively

To remove a coffee stain from a carpet, start by blotting the area immediately with a clean cloth to absorb as much liquid as possible without rubbing. Apply a solution of warm water mixed with mild dish soap or a small amount of white vinegar, then gently blot again to lift the stain. For stubborn stains, sprinkle baking soda after cleaning to absorb remaining moisture and odor, then vacuum once dry. Acting quickly and avoiding harsh scrubbing helps prevent the stain from setting permanently and protects carpet fibers.


How to Use a Fire Extinguisher Step by Step

Using a fire extinguisher correctly is essential for controlling small fires safely. Follow the PASS method: Pull the pin to unlock the extinguisher, Aim the nozzle at the base of the fire, Squeeze the handle to release the extinguishing agent, and Sweep the nozzle from side to side until the fire is out. Always stand at a safe distance, ensure the fire is small and manageable, and keep an exit route behind you. If the fire grows or becomes uncontrollable, evacuate immediately and contact emergency services.


Simple and Sustainable Ways to Lose Weight Safely

The easiest and most effective way to lose weight is to maintain a consistent calorie deficit by eating balanced meals with whole foods, controlling portion sizes, and staying physically active through simple routines like walking or light exercise. Rather than extreme diets, focusing on sustainable habits such as reducing processed foods, increasing protein and fiber intake, staying hydrated, and getting adequate sleep helps regulate metabolism and prevent weight regain. This approach works because it aligns with how the body naturally uses energy, making weight loss gradual, safer, and easier to maintain over time.


Advantages and Disadvantages of Menstrual Cups

Menstrual cups are reusable, bell-shaped devices designed to collect menstrual fluid, offering several advantages such as long-term cost savings, reduced environmental waste, and extended wear time compared to disposable products. They are typically made from medical-grade materials, making them a durable and eco-friendly option. However, disadvantages include a learning curve for insertion and removal, the need for regular cleaning and sterilization, and potential discomfort or leakage if not used correctly. Additionally, access to clean water and private sanitation facilities can affect usability, making them less convenient in certain settings.


Effective Ways to Relieve Hip Pain Quickly

The fastest way to relieve hip pain depends on the cause, but immediate relief often comes from resting the joint, applying ice to reduce inflammation, or using heat to relax tight muscles. Over-the-counter pain relievers and gentle stretching exercises can further reduce discomfort and improve mobility. Maintaining proper posture, avoiding activities that worsen the pain, and gradually strengthening surrounding muscles are important for longer-term relief. If pain is severe, persistent, or caused by injury, medical evaluation is necessary to ensure appropriate treatment and prevent complications.


What Shopify Is and How It Works

Shopify is a cloud-based e-commerce platform that enables users to build, customize, and operate online stores without needing advanced technical skills. It provides a centralized system where merchants can design storefronts using templates, list and manage products, track inventory, process payments through integrated gateways, and handle shipping and order fulfillment. Shopify operates on a subscription model, offering scalable features and third-party app integrations that support business growth, making it widely used by entrepreneurs, small businesses, and large enterprises for selling products across websites, social media, and marketplaces.
